Transaction 8b40eebcca793fa43774966f9aa0b5994c8a120666059d8207011a5031325963
1 Input
1 Output
-
8b40eebcca793fa43774966f9aa0b5994c8a120666059d8207011a5031325963:0
- value
- 14529994
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 692ade7e51a143abe6ecd629feffeb2c9e20e72c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Ab5Jjx7UkM2yv9321WAuUen1VCfBetRbo